Proven Strategies to Showcase Digital Transformation Impact to Executives
To elevate your promotion efforts, implement these eight strategies that translate technical achievements into executive-level impact:
1. Align Impact Metrics with Executive Priorities
Executives prioritize business outcomes such as revenue growth, cost reduction, speed to market, and customer experience. Tailoring your metrics to these priorities ensures your message resonates.
2. Use Data Storytelling Enhanced by Visualizations
Transform complex data into clear, concise narratives supported by visuals like charts, heat maps, and trend lines. This storytelling approach turns analytics into compelling business cases.
3. Leverage Real-Time and Continuous Feedback Loops
Deploy continuous feedback mechanisms to gather stakeholder and user input in real time. This dynamic data enables you to showcase ongoing improvements and adjust messaging promptly.
4. Showcase Before-and-After Scenarios with Comparative Metrics
Demonstrate transformation impact through baseline and post-implementation data. Case studies humanize the numbers, making results relatable and credible.
5. Develop Tailored Executive Dashboards
Create dashboards that provide executives with at-a-glance insights into project status, ROI, risks, and adoption rates—facilitating quick understanding and informed decisions.
6. Highlight Both Quantitative and Qualitative Outcomes
Combine hard numbers with testimonials, quotes, and user stories to present a balanced, persuasive impact report.
7. Engage Executives Early and Often
Involve executives through regular updates, workshops, and feedback sessions to foster ownership and advocacy throughout the transformation journey.
8. Prioritize Transparency and Honesty
Share challenges and lessons learned alongside successes to build credibility and trust, which strengthens your professional brand.
How to Implement Each Strategy Effectively: Concrete Steps and Examples
1. Align Impact Metrics with Executive Priorities
- Step 1: Conduct interviews or surveys to identify executive KPIs.
- Step 2: Map your initiative outcomes to these KPIs.
- Step 3: Set measurable targets tied to business goals.
- Step 4: Communicate progress using executive-friendly language.
Example: If customer retention is a priority, track and report changes in churn rate following your digital transformation efforts.
2. Use Data Storytelling Enhanced by Visualizations
- Step 1: Extract key data points from analytics.
- Step 2: Use visualization tools like Tableau or Power BI to create engaging charts.
- Step 3: Craft narratives that connect data to business impact.
- Step 4: Present visuals with clear takeaways during executive meetings.
Example: Show a line graph of reduced process cycle times alongside a client testimonial praising improved efficiency.
3. Leverage Real-Time and Continuous Feedback Loops
- Step 1: Deploy feedback platforms such as Zigpoll or similar survey tools to capture ongoing user sentiment.
- Step 2: Set automated alerts for critical feedback trends.
- Step 3: Integrate feedback into regular reporting cycles.
- Step 4: Use insights to refine messaging and project focus dynamically.
Example: Share real-time Net Promoter Score (NPS) improvements immediately after a UI redesign to demonstrate impact.
4. Showcase Before-and-After Scenarios with Comparative Metrics
- Step 1: Collect baseline data before starting initiatives.
- Step 2: Measure the same metrics post-implementation.
- Step 3: Highlight percentage improvements and cost savings.
- Step 4: Package these results as case studies with visuals.
Example: Demonstrate a 30% reduction in processing time and $500K in annual savings from automation.
5. Develop Tailored Executive Dashboards
- Step 1: Identify key executive metrics.
- Step 2: Use dashboard tools like Klipfolio, Domo, or Google Data Studio.
- Step 3: Design intuitive dashboards with drill-down features.
- Step 4: Schedule regular updates and provide secure access links.
Example: A dashboard displaying milestones, cost variance, and adoption rates updated weekly for executive review.
6. Highlight Both Quantitative and Qualitative Outcomes
- Step 1: Collect user testimonials and stakeholder quotes.
- Step 2: Pair stories with supporting data.
- Step 3: Share these in reports, newsletters, and presentations.
- Step 4: Use multimedia testimonials (e.g., videos) for greater impact.
Example: A client quote praising faster decision-making paired with data showing reduced report generation time.
7. Engage Executives Early and Often
- Step 1: Schedule regular check-ins and workshops.
- Step 2: Provide preview reports before major presentations.
- Step 3: Solicit and incorporate executive feedback.
- Step 4: Tailor messaging based on executive input.
Example: Monthly executive roundtables to review progress and identify new opportunities.
8. Prioritize Transparency and Honesty
- Step 1: Document challenges and mitigation strategies.
- Step 2: Include lessons learned in reports.
- Step 3: Communicate risks proactively.
- Step 4: Foster a culture of accountability.
Example: Share initial resistance to change and how targeted training improved adoption rates.

FAQ: Key Questions About Showcasing Digital Transformation Impact
What is the best way to show digital transformation impact to executives?
Align your metrics with executive priorities, use clear data visualizations, and combine quantitative results with qualitative stories. Implement real-time feedback and executive dashboards to maintain visibility.
How often should I report progress to executives?
Monthly or quarterly reports are standard, but provide real-time dashboard access for ongoing transparency. Frequent communication builds trust and enables timely adjustments.
What metrics matter most to executives for digital transformation?
Revenue impact, cost savings, time-to-market improvements, customer satisfaction (NPS/CSAT), and operational efficiency are top priorities.
How can feedback tools like Zigpoll help in capability promotion?
They capture continuous user sentiment and experience data, enabling you to provide executives with real-time, actionable insights that demonstrate ongoing impact.
How do I handle challenges or failures in impact reporting?
Be transparent about obstacles and your mitigation strategies. Executives value honesty, which strengthens your credibility and fosters collaborative problem-solving.
